The Acknowledgment of Paternity document is designed to formally establish a legal relationship between a father and his child, affirming the paternity voluntarily and without coercion. This document is crucial for situations where the parents are not married, allowing the father to claim his child as part of his estate, conferring the same rights as a legitimate child. Key features include essential identification fields for the father, mother, and child, along with the declaration that the child shall inherit from the father's estate. To effectively fill out the form, users must provide accurate personal information and ensure that their declarations are witnessed and notarized to meet legal requirements. To obtain an acknowledgment of paternity, you must complete a form that identifies both parents and the child. This form can often be found at hospitals, local health departments, or state vital records offices. After filling out the acknowledgment paternity document for editing, both parents must sign it in the presence of a witness or notary. Finally, you can submit the signed document to the appropriate state office for filing.
